## Service Accounts — Scanwick Integration

The Scanwick barcode scanner integration runs under the `svc-scanwick-ingest` account. It has read/write access to the label queue only; it cannot touch inventory totals. If ingestion stalls, restart the bridge pod first. For manual API calls during an incident, authenticate with the service account's key, shown below:

app token of tadug-yahag = vxb3-949

Handover note — Crumbwheel order cutoffs.

Welcome aboard. The bakery cutoff rule in Crumbwheel closes same-day orders at 14:00 local to each storefront, not UTC — this has bitten us twice. Holiday overrides live in the calendar service and take precedence silently, so always check there first when a cutoff looks wrong. To unlock the calendar service's admin console after a restart, enter the recovery passphrase below.

vault phrase of bagap-bahaf = silion-pelox-sorox-casdor-quenwyn-fraax-eliox-praael-kelion-quenvan-kasox-rusael-norius-belvan

// Fixture: shipping-fee rules engine (project Cartwheel).
// These cases cover the weird ones: oversized-but-light parcels,
// the Dunmore Island surcharge, and the free-shipping override that
// kicks in above the promo threshold. If you touch the rule priority
// order, rerun the whole matrix — the engine short-circuits and the
// bugs hide in case 7. The fixture loader pulls live rate tables
// from the staging rates service, authenticating with the token below.

portal login ticket: eyJhbGciOiJIUzI1NiIsInR5cCI6IkpXVCJ9.eyJzdWIiOiIwEOsktwVNwIn0.-UJU3fdyyCgG

**Vendor note: Inkmill markdown pipeline**

Rendering for Parchway docs is outsourced to Inkmill under an annual contract, renewing each March. They handle sanitization and PDF export; we own the upload queue. SLA: 4-hour response on rendering failures. Escalate only after two failed retries. Their support desk is reachable at the address below.

billing contact of hahaf-baguf = zorael.tammir.jorius@sivrelhq.internal